The esoteric ism of King Dasaratha and self-realization.


'DASARATHA' is the king of 'AYODHYA' with his three wives, 'KOUSALLYA', 'SUMITHRA', 'KAIKEYI' and four sons, 'SREE RAMA', 'LAKSHMANA', 'BHARATHA' and 'SATHRUGHNA'. Later Dasaratha left for his heavenly abode, when Rama and Sita went for their forest-life.
Dasaratha:
  Represents the body-mind-intellect complex with the five sense organs and the five organs of action ( eyes, ears, nose, tongue, skin and the organs of speech, excretion, procreation, feet, and arms ).
Kousallya, Sumithra and Kaikeyi :
  Represents 'ICHA', 'KRIYA' and 'JNANA'- the desire-prompted actions which finally culminates in self-knowledge.
Rama, Lakshmana, Bharatha and Sathrughna:
  Represents the four states of consciousness, the wakeful, dream, deep sleep and the fourth state of super consciousness ( Viswan, Thaijasan, pranjnan and thuriyan ).

Moral of the story

Dasaratha implies our body-mind-intellect complex with five sense organs and organs of action, indulging in the phenomenal world, through the three states of consciousness ( wakeful, dream, and deep sleep), with 'I am the body- consciousness    ( DEHOHAM ). When there is self-realization through 'BRAHMA VIDYA' (The science of practicing pure awareness), the 'DEHOHAM' ( I-am the body consciousness ) gives way to 'BRAHMOHAM' ( I-am truth-consciousness and bliss), resulting in  'Sahaja - Samadhi' and 'Liberation-in-Life'
